Output 8493409c39d1771e32fe99a84649696592f0c98b2e6fd1acfdae073d59ca3d7f:7

value
3046206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64baeca469d2c5d71f31072a52309561ffaca47e OP_EQUAL
address
3AsdRTfwh6Sievs96XPYragyixSj4WFJiN
transaction
8493409c39d1771e32fe99a84649696592f0c98b2e6fd1acfdae073d59ca3d7f
spent
true